Understanding the Pervasive Nature of Waste in Small Manufacturing Operations

Before delving into how Cloud ERP specifically tackles waste, it’s crucial to grasp what we mean by “waste” in a manufacturing context. Often associated with the Lean manufacturing philosophy, waste (or “Muda” in Japanese) refers to any activity that consumes resources without adding value to the customer. For small manufacturers, the impact of these non-value-added activities is disproportionately high due to tighter margins, smaller teams, and less buffer for error. Recognizing these waste streams is the first step towards effective reduction.

Traditional manufacturing environments, especially those relying on manual processes or disconnected legacy systems, are breeding grounds for waste. Common culprits include overproduction – making more than is needed, leading to storage costs and potential obsolescence – and excessive inventory, which ties up capital and occupies precious physical space. These aren’t just minor inconveniences; they represent tangible financial losses and missed opportunities for growth. What Exactly is Cloud ERP and Why Does it Matter for Small Businesses?

Enterprise Resource Planning (ERP) systems have been around for decades, designed to integrate core business processes such as finance, HR, manufacturing, supply chain, services, procurement, and more into a single system. Historically, ERP was a massive undertaking, requiring significant upfront investment in hardware, software licenses, and dedicated IT staff – making it largely inaccessible for small manufacturers. However, the advent of “Cloud ERP” has democratized this powerful technology, making it not only viable but highly advantageous for businesses of all sizes.

Cloud ERP operates on the principle of software-as-a-service (SaaS), meaning the software and its associated data are hosted on the internet and accessed via a web browser. Instead of purchasing and maintaining complex infrastructure, small manufacturers pay a subscription fee, significantly lowering the barrier to entry. This fundamental shift from on-premise to cloud-based solutions brings unprecedented scalability, flexibility, and accessibility. It allows small businesses to leverage sophisticated tools previously only available to large corporations, transforming their ability to compete and optimize their operations without the burden of managing complex IT environments.

Optimizing Inventory Management and Minimizing Excess Stockholding

Excess inventory is one of the most visible and costly forms of waste for small manufacturers. It ties up working capital, incurs storage costs (including rent, utilities, insurance, and labor for handling), and risks obsolescence, especially for products with short shelf lives or rapidly changing designs. Cloud ERP systems directly address this challenge by transforming how inventory is managed, moving from guesswork to precision. They provide real-time visibility into stock levels across multiple locations, including raw materials, work-in-progress (WIP), and finished goods.

Beyond simple stock counting, Cloud ERP integrates demand forecasting tools with actual sales data, production schedules, and supplier lead times. This sophisticated analytical capability allows small manufacturers to predict future demand with greater accuracy, enabling them to order raw materials and schedule production precisely when needed, rather than building up buffer stock “just in case.” The result is a dramatic reduction in excess inventory, leading to significant cost savings, improved cash flow, and more efficient use of warehouse space. Moreover, by reducing the risk of holding outdated or damaged stock, Cloud ERP mitigates further potential financial losses, turning what was once a liability into a lean asset.

Enhancing Quality Control and Drastically Reducing Defects and Rework

Defects and rework are perhaps the most infuriating forms of waste. They not only consume additional materials and labor but also delay delivery, damage customer satisfaction, and can harm a brand’s reputation. For small manufacturers, the cost of defects, especially when discovered late in the production cycle or, worse, by the customer, can be devastating. Cloud ERP systems, through their integrated quality management modules, offer a powerful antidote to this problem by embedding quality control directly into the manufacturing process rather than treating it as an afterthought.

A robust Cloud ERP can track materials from supplier to finished product, providing complete traceability. If a defect is discovered, it becomes significantly easier to identify the source of the problem – whether it’s a faulty batch of raw materials or an issue with a specific machine or process step. Furthermore, Cloud ERP allows for the establishment of quality checkpoints throughout production, enabling real-time data collection on performance and deviations. By flagging issues early, before they escalate, small manufacturers can intervene promptly, rectify problems, and prevent entire batches from becoming scrap or requiring costly rework. This proactive approach not only saves materials and labor but also significantly boosts customer satisfaction and reinforces the manufacturer’s commitment to quality.

Implementation Challenges and Best Practices for a Successful Transition

While the benefits of Cloud ERP are compelling, successfully implementing such a system is not without its challenges. Small manufacturers, with limited IT resources and often deeply ingrained traditional processes, must approach implementation strategically to maximize the return on investment and avoid creating new forms of waste during the transition. Common hurdles include data migration from old systems, resistance to change from employees accustomed to familiar workflows, and the initial learning curve associated with new software.

To ensure a smooth and successful transition, several best practices are critical. First, involve key stakeholders from all relevant departments early in the planning process to foster buy-in and address concerns. Second, dedicate sufficient time to accurate data cleansing and migration; “garbage in, garbage out” applies emphatically to ERP. Third, invest in comprehensive training for all users, emphasizing not just how to use the software but why the changes are beneficial. Finally, partner with a reputable Cloud ERP vendor that offers strong support and has experience working with small manufacturing businesses. A phased implementation approach, starting with critical modules and gradually rolling out others, can also help manage complexity and minimize disruption, turning potential challenges into manageable steps towards greater efficiency.

Real-World Scenarios: How Cloud ERP Transforms Day-to-Day Operations

To truly appreciate the impact of Cloud ERP, it’s helpful to visualize its effects in common small manufacturing scenarios. Consider a small custom furniture manufacturer struggling with long lead times and frequent errors in customer orders. Orders would come in via email, then manually transcribed into spreadsheets for production, leading to transcription errors and lost details. Production schedules were chaotic, based on a whiteboard, and inventory was counted manually, leading to stockouts or excess wood rotting in the yard. The result was frustrated customers, wasted materials, and stressed employees.

Implementing a Cloud ERP system completely transforms this. Customer orders are entered directly into the ERP, flowing instantly to production planning. The system automatically checks material availability, schedules production slots based on machine capacity, and generates precise cut lists, minimizing wood waste. Real-time inventory tracking ensures the right materials are always on hand. Production workers access digital work orders on tablets, eliminating paper waste and errors. When a customer calls for an update, the sales team has immediate, accurate information. This shift moves the business from reactive firefighting to proactive, synchronized operations, directly reducing waste, improving efficiency, and enhancing customer satisfaction.

Choosing the Right Cloud ERP for Your Small Manufacturing Business

The market for Cloud ERP solutions is vast and varied, making the selection process a critical decision for any small manufacturer. Choosing the wrong system can itself become a source of future waste if it doesn’t align with business needs, is difficult to use, or lacks adequate support. Therefore, a thorough evaluation process is essential, focusing on factors beyond just the initial price tag.

Key considerations include the vendor’s experience with small manufacturing businesses and their specific industry (e.g., discrete, process, make-to-order). The system should offer the core functionalities necessary for manufacturing operations, such as production planning, inventory management, quality control, and financial accounting, with the flexibility to add more specialized modules as needed. User-friendliness, scalability, integration capabilities with other essential tools (like CAD software or e-commerce platforms), and the quality of customer support and training are also paramount. It’s advisable to request demonstrations, speak with existing customers, and carefully review the total cost of ownership over several years, including subscription fees, implementation costs, and potential customization expenses.
